Community Polytechnic Scheme

LIst of Polytechnics

The Government of India in the Ministry of Human Resource Development have introduced Community Polytechnic Scheme in the year 1970 to develop interaction with rural people, especially for educated unemployed youth. The Government of India provided 100% aid to this Scheme in respect of both recurring and non recurring funds which covers the purchase of machinery& equipment and allied materials to train the rural youth in different trades.

Aims and objectives:

1.To transfer technology to village level.
2.To train educated unemployed youth as skilled men/ Women for the development in appropriate trade suitable    to the village
3.To provide services for enrichment of social and cultural life in the rural areas.
4.To develop production cum training centres.
5.Community development

6.Dissemination of information on rural development.

Activities :

1.Socio economic survey and planning.
2.Transfer of technology.
3.Manpower Development and Training.
4.Technical services.
5.Support services
6.Dissemination of Information
